Buying property in Spain involves navigating several legal requirements. From essential documents to dealing with local authorities, understanding these aspects is key to a smooth transaction.
The legal landscape can seem daunting, but knowing the necessary documents simplifies the process. First, ensure you have a NIE number, which is crucial for any property transaction in Spain. You’ll also need a valid passport and proof of financial means.
A purchase agreement, or “Contrato de Arras,” often follows once you’re ready to make an offer. This preliminary contract outlines the terms and conditions of the sale. Remember, having a professional review these documents can prevent future complications. Most people overlook this step, but it can save you from potential pitfalls.

Interacting with local authorities is part of the property buying process in Spain. You’ll need to register the purchase with the land registry to ensure legal ownership. This step is crucial for protecting your investment and avoiding disputes.
Local town halls may also require you to pay property taxes. Staying informed about these obligations prevents unexpected expenses. The quicker you handle these, the sooner you can enjoy your new property.
